Some Pairs

Maylin Hausch & Daniel Wende GER
SP November Rain (written by Guns N'Roses, performed by David Garett), choreo Anjelika Krylova
They are going back to an old LP

Cheng Peng & Hao Zhang of China are using Crouching Tiger, Hidden Dragon for the Sp & Yellow River Concerto for the LP

Tarah Kayne &Danny O'Shea's programs are From Russia with Love - James Bond film (SP) and Don Quixote - ballet by Minkus. choreographed by Jim Peterson:
 
Keegan Messing is using his old SP to Sing, Sing, Sing. His new LP will be to the Mask of Zorro soundtrack. Keegan will be competing at Liberty next week.

Takahiko Kozuka just performed his SP at an ice show.
It is Unsquare Dance, choreo Shae Lynn Bourne. He had previously revealed his LP is to Rondo Capriccioso
 
From the Skate Milwaukee thread, Carly Gold's SP is to Carmen (she won) and Davis & Brubaker's SP is to Latin/tango music.
